1. Understanding Mobile Battery Degradation

Why Do Phone Batteries Wear Out?

Every time you charge your phone, it goes through a charge cycle. Over time, these cycles degrade the battery’s ability to hold a charge. After about 500 charge cycles, most batteries start to show signs of wear.

Signs You Need a Battery Replacement

  • The battery drains quickly, even with minimal use.
  • Your phone shuts down unexpectedly.
  • The battery takes too long to charge or doesn’t charge at all.
  • The phone overheats frequently.
  • A swollen or bulging battery (this is a safety hazard!).

6. Myths About Mobile Battery Replacement

Myth #1: Only the Manufacturer Can Replace Batteries

Many third-party services use genuine or high-quality compatible batteries that work just as well.

Myth #2: Replacing a Battery Will Erase Data

No, a battery replacement does not affect phone data. However, always back up your data before any repair service.

Myth #3: DIY Replacement is Better

Without the right tools and expertise, a DIY battery replacement can damage your phone.
